Just safety mods (roll cage, 5 point harness and bucket seat, kill switch, fire extinguisher), weight reductions, racing tires, and upgraded the brake fluid from DOT 3 to DOT 4. Other than that it’s bone stock.

I know I’m preaching to the choir, but the Democrats of the late 1800s/early-mid 1900s were basically an entirely different political party than modern democrats in terms of actual beliefs. They were basically the opposite of what they are today and were functionally the same as modern Republicans belief wise. The reverse is true for the Republicans then and now too.

The real shift started in the 1930s and saw its true conclusion in the 1980s. First we begin with the Democrat party pushing more socialist policies with Franklin D. Roosevelt, as he pushed for the New Deal to try and pull the U.S. out of the Great Depression by creating social safety nets such as Social Security, improving worker’s rights and safety, regulating the stock market, and pushing for public works projects to stimulate the economy and create jobs while improving the country’s infrastructure.

Next was Lyndon B Johnson in 1964 when he passed the Civil Rights Act, which made segregation and systematic discrimination against Black Americans illegal. This cemented the Democrats as the civil rights party, and alienated the deeply conservative/racist old school southern Democrats. After signing the Civil Rights Act LBJ famously said “we lost the South for a generation” and he was absolutely right.

During his 1968 election campaign, Richard Nixon pushed the “Southern Strategy”, pushing racist policies to gain the vote of the Southern Democrats who felt dropped by LBJ. The strategy worked, and all the former Confederate/racist Democrats jumped ship to the Republican Party.

Lastly, after the 1970s economic crash, Ronald Reagan pushed for “trickle down economics”, prioritizing tax cuts for the rich and companies under the belief that money would eventually trickle down to the working class. In the short term, Reagan benefited from the work Jimmy Carter did to try and fix the economy that didn’t fully take effect in his term as well as the short term economic stimulation that came from the tax cuts, but with no reduction in government spending, national debt began to stack, the consequences of which would not manifest until well after his Presidency. His trickle down economic policies also caused the class divide to widen significantly long term, leading to the major wealth gap problem we have today. Ultimately this made the Republican Party the new party of the top 1% of the population. Nope, most narrowbody jets such as the 737 and A320 can't dump fuel and in emergencies typically are either forced to fly a holding pattern until they are below MLAW or prepare for an above MLAW landing and take precautions to attempt to make it safely.

I imagine most private jets lack fuel dumping too. Its typically reserved for widebody jets.
